[HTML][HTML] Cell survival during complete nutrient deprivation depends on lipid droplet-fueled β-oxidation of fatty acids

AG Cabodevilla, L Sánchez-Caballero, E Nintou… - Journal of Biological …, 2013 - ASBMB
Cells exposed to stress of different origins synthesize triacylglycerols and generate lipid
droplets (LD), but the physiological relevance of this response is uncertain. Using complete
nutrient deprivation of cells in culture as a simple model of stress, we have addressed
whether LD biogenesis has a protective role in cells committed to die. Complete nutrient
deprivation induced the biogenesis of LD in human LN18 glioblastoma and HeLa cells and
